Understanding CPU and Motherboard Compatibility
Choosing compatible components is crucial for a successful PC build. I’ve seen countless beginners make expensive mistakes by mixing incompatible parts. The socket type is the first thing to check – Intel uses LGA 1700 for 12th-14th gen CPUs, while AMD uses AM4 for older processors and AM5 for the latest 7000 series.
Beyond the socket, the chipset determines features and capabilities. For Intel, B760 offers mainstream features while Z790 adds overclocking support. AMD’s B650 provides good value, while X670E offers maximum connectivity with PCIe 5.0 for both graphics and storage.
Memory compatibility is another critical factor. DDR4 remains the budget choice with widespread availability, while DDR5 offers higher bandwidth at a premium. Some Intel platforms support both, providing upgrade flexibility.
⚠️ Important: Always check the motherboard’s QVL (Qualified Vendor List) for RAM compatibility. Even with the correct type and speed, some memory kits may not work properly without BIOS updates.
Power delivery becomes increasingly important with high-end CPUs. Look for motherboards with adequate VRM phases and cooling if you plan to use power-hungry processors or overclock. Budget boards may struggle with power-hungry 14-core Intel CPUs.
Buying Guide for CPU and Motherboard Combos
After testing dozens of combinations and building countless systems, I’ve learned that the best combo depends entirely on your specific needs and budget. Let me help you navigate the choices based on real-world use cases.
Solving for Budget Gaming: Look for AMD AM4 Value
For gaming under $200 total for CPU and motherboard, AMD’s AM4 platform offers unbeatable value. The Ryzen 5 4500 or 5500 paired with an A520 motherboard delivers smooth 1080p gaming when paired with a decent GPU. While you’re buying older technology, the performance per dollar is outstanding.
Remember to factor in GPU cost – these CPUs don’t have integrated graphics. Budget an additional $150-200 for an entry-level graphics card like the RX 6500 XT or GTX 1650.
Solving for Future-Proofing: Choose AM5
AMD’s AM5 platform represents the future with DDR5 and PCIe 5.0 support. While more expensive today, these combos will support future Zen 5 CPUs for years to come. The Ryzen 5 7600X offers the best entry point, with integrated graphics as a bonus.
DDR5 memory prices are dropping rapidly, making AM5 more accessible. We expect AM5 to be relevant through at least 2026, providing a clear upgrade path for budget-conscious builders wanting longevity.
Solving for Productivity: Intel’s Efficiency Cores Win
For content creation and professional workloads, Intel’s hybrid architecture with efficiency cores excels. The i5-14400 provides 10 cores that handle multitasking beautifully, often beating AMD in rendering and encoding tasks.
The included Intel graphics provide adequate display output for productivity, allowing you to defer GPU purchase if needed. Intel’s platforms also tend to have better driver stability for professional applications.
Solving for Maximum Gaming FPS: 3D V-Cache is King
Competitive gamers should strongly consider AMD’s 3D V-Cache CPUs. The additional L3 cache significantly improves gaming performance, especially in CPU-bound scenarios. The 7800X3D consistently outperforms more expensive CPUs in many games.
The tradeoff is slightly lower productivity performance, but serious gamers will appreciate the smoother gameplay and higher minimum frame rates. This technology represents the biggest gaming innovation in years for AMD.
✅ Pro Tip: Don’t forget cooling! Budget combos often include adequate coolers, but high-end CPUs need aftermarket solutions. Plan $30-60 for quality air cooling, or $100+ for all-in-one liquid cooling.
Solving for Connectivity: WiFi 6E and Beyond
If wireless networking is essential, look for combos with modern WiFi solutions. WiFi 6E provides access to the 6GHz band with less interference, while WiFi 7 future-proofs your build for next-gen routers.
Ethernet remains superior for competitive gaming, but good WiFi provides flexibility for different room setups. Consider your networking needs before choosing a motherboard without integrated wireless.
Frequently Asked Questions
Are CPU and motherboard combos worth it?
CPU and motherboard combos are absolutely worth it for guaranteed compatibility and often better pricing. Manufacturers test these combinations extensively, so you know they’ll work together out of the box. The peace of mind and potential savings of $20-50 make bundles an excellent choice for most builders.
Can I use any CPU with any motherboard?
No, CPUs are not universally compatible with motherboards. You must match three key factors: socket type (e.g., AM5, LGA 1700), chipset compatibility, and BIOS support. Even with the right socket, older motherboards may need BIOS updates to recognize newer CPUs. Always check compatibility before purchasing.
What makes a good CPU motherboard combo?
A good CPU motherboard combo balances performance, features, and price while ensuring complete compatibility. Look for adequate power delivery on the motherboard, enough connectivity options for your needs, future upgrade potential, and a price that fits your budget. The best combos avoid bottlenecks while providing headroom for your intended use case.
How much should I spend on CPU and motherboard?
Budget builders should spend $150-300 for solid 1080p gaming performance. Mid-range systems typically cost $300-500 for 1440p capability. High-end combos run $500-1000+ for 4K gaming and professional workloads. Generally, allocate 20-30% of your total build budget to CPU and motherboard combined.
Is a $500 motherboard worth it?
A $500 motherboard is only worth it for extreme overclockers, users needing extensive connectivity (10G LAN, multiple NVMe slots), or professionals requiring specific features. For gaming and typical productivity, $200-300 motherboards offer 95% of the performance at half the price. Premium boards mainly provide marginal improvements in power delivery and aesthetics.
